| *[http://www.ethnologue.com/show_country.asp?name=Afghanistan Languages/Ethnologue] | | ==Description== |
| | With upwards of 40 distinct languages, Afghanistan is a linguistically diverse nation.<br> |
| | The [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Dari '''Dari or Dari Persian '''] and [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pashto '''Pashto'''] have official status in Afghanistan and are two of the leading languages in the country. <br> |
| | *[https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Dari '''Dari or Dari Persian ''']<br> |
| | ** is spoken by 78% as a native language or 2nd language |
| | ** is the most widely understood language as a shared language between multiple ethnic groups in the country<br> |
| | ** has served as a historical Lingua Franca between different linguistic groups in the region<br> |
| | ** is an [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Iranian_languages Irainian Language] <br> |
| | *[https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pashto '''Pashto''']<br> |
| | ** is spoken by 35% |
| | ** is not multi-ethnic and is not as commonly spoken by non-Pashtuns |
| | ** is an [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Iranian_languages Iranian language] <ref>Wikipedia contributors, "Languages of Afghanistan," in ''Wikipedia: the Free Encyclopedia'', https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Languages_of_Afghanistan, accessed 15 May 2023.</ref> |
| | |
| | Other regional languages are spoken by minority groups across the country. They are the third official languages in areas where the majority speaks them. These include: <ref>Wikipedia contributors, "Languages of Afghanistan," in ''Wikipedia: the Free Encyclopedia'', https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Languages_of_Afghanistan, accessed 15 May 2023.</ref> |
| | * [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Uzbek_language '''Uzbek'''] is spoken by 10% |
| | * [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Turkmen_language '''Turkmen'''] is spoken by 2% |
| | * [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Balochi_language '''Balochi'''] is spoken by 1% |
| | * [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Pashayi_languages '''Pashayi'''] is spoken by 1% |
| | * [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Nuristani_languages '''Nuristani'''] is spoken by 1% |
| | |
| | English is most spoken as a foreign language. <ref>Wikipedia contributors, "Languages of Afghanistan," in ''Wikipedia: the Free Encyclopedia'', https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Languages_of_Afghanistan, accessed 15 May 2023.</ref> |
